- MeshCore-based Simple Sensor firmware - Heltec T114 without display - BME280 sensor support (temp/humidity/pressure) - Radio: 868.856018 MHz, SF7, BW62.5 kHz, CR4/7 - 2-byte path hash - PlatformIO project
